Largest Public School Student Size By School District

Listed below are school districts with the largest average student size (2026).
The school district with largest average public school student size is Hallsville Independent School District (TX) with 3,515 students. The school district with smallest average public school student size is Nm Corrections School District (NM) with 3 students.

What districts have the public schools with the largest student size?
The districts with the largest student size are Hallsville Independent School District, TX (3,515 students average student size), Township HSD 211 School District, IL (2,492 students average student size) and Agua Fria Union High School District (4289), AZ (2,018 students average student size).

The state with largest average public school student size is Georgia , with 751 students. The county with the largest average public school student size is Oneida County, ID with 1,451 students.
